2005 - 2006 LEGISLATURE
SENATE AMENDMENT 2,
TO 2005 SENATE BILL 505
February 9, 2006 - Offered by Senator Brown.
SB505-SA2,1,11 At the locations indicated, amend the bill as follows:
SB505-SA2,1,2 21. Page 3, line 15: delete lines 15 to 19 and substitute:
SB505-SA2,1,4 3"101.615 (2m) (a) In this subsection, "inspection agency" means a municipality,
4as defined in s. 101.651 (1), a county, or the department.
SB505-SA2,1,105 (b) A dwelling is exempt from all construction and inspection standards, rules,
6orders, codes, and regulations that are adopted, promulgated, enforced, and
7administered by the department under this subchapter and from all enforcement
8and inspection ordinances and other regulations that are enacted and enforced by
9the department, a county, or a municipality under s. 101.651 (1) if all of the following
10are satisfied:".
SB505-SA2,1,11 112. Page 4, line 4: after that line insert:
SB505-SA2,2,5 12"(am) Before beginning construction on a dwelling, or on an addition to a
13dwelling, an owner claiming the exemption under par. (b) shall file a notice of

1exemption with the inspecting agency that would be responsible for inspecting the
2construction. The owner shall pay a fee to file this notice in an amount equal to the
3building permit fee or any other fee that the owner would pay to the municipality to
4proceed with the construction if the owner was not filing a notice of exemption under
5this paragraph.".
